Context
23All things are lawful for me, but all things are not expedient: all things are lawful for me, but all things edify not.
24Let no man seek his own, but every man another’s
25Whatsoever is sold in the shambles, eat, asking no question for conscience sake:
26For the earth the Lord’s, and the fulness thereof.
27If any of them that believe not bid you and ye be disposed to go; whatsoever is set before you, eat, asking no question for conscience sake.
28But if any man say unto you, This is offered in sacrifice unto idols, eat not for his sake that shewed it, and for conscience sake: for the earth the Lord’s, and the fulness thereof:
29Conscience, I say, not thine own, but of the other: for why is my liberty judged of another conscience?
